The position is based in Accor's flagship Canberra hotel, Novotel Canberra, conveniently based in the city centre opposite the light rail. We are a 286-room hotel with 8 conferencing and event facilities hosting all events from Corporate groups to sports teams. Job Description We’re looking for a professional and customer-focused Assistant Restaurant & Bar Manager to join our team at Novotel Canberra! In this hands-on leadership role, you’ll support the Food & Beverage Manager in running daily operations, delivering outstanding service, and maintaining high standards across the venue. What You’ll Be Doing: Help manage the day-to-day operations of the restaurant and bar Support and guide the team through training and supervision Assist with rostering and shift scheduling Contribute to menu planning and pricing Monitor and uphold quality standards in food and beverage service Support budgeting and cost control efforts Ensure compliance with health, safety, and hospitality standards Oversee inventory and stock control Manage cash handling and reconcile daily sales Respond to customer enquiries and feedback professionally Maintain a clean, welcoming environment for guests Qualifications 2–3 years’ experience in restaurant or bar management Proven leadership and team supervision in hospitality Passion for delivering exceptional customer service Skilled in staff training and development Confident using POS systems and inventory software Solid understanding of food & beverage operations, including menu planning and wine pairing Knowledge of Australian health & safety regulations Experience with budgeting and cost control Excellent communication and people skills Flexibility to work evenings, weekends, and public holidays Hospitality Management qualification (preferred) Current RSA certification Strong problem-solving and decision-making abilities Additional Information In return for your commitment, we offer: Enjoy discounted Heartist® rates across our global network of properties, food and beverage venues, and wellness centers.
